  • Im looking at geting one of these, excelent condition, lots of chrome, all leather. 200k Miles though. You think $1,500 is a fair price?

  • @scamperscamper1 If there are no issues, i'd take it! Mine cost 1200 but it had a boatload of issues and 350k+ miles. Ended up selling for only 1k despite putting in over 2k trying to fix the darn thing. It was a good learning experience for me, though; learned alot about these cars.

    Like I said, as long as there are no issues. These cars were built like tanks, but it depends on how you treat these things how long they would last (these should be million-and-a-half mile cars if taken care of!)
